Seared pineapple with orange-macerated strawberries

Method

 
1. Remove the core of the pineapple if necessary. Put the pineapple in a saucepan with the stock syrup and cardamom pods. Place over a medium-low heat and poach gently for 2 hours.

2. Meanwhile, put half the strawberries in a food processor or liquidiser. Add the orange liqueur, lemon juice and icing sugar and blend until smooth. Transfer to a jug and stir in the orange zest.

3. Cut the rest of the strawberries into quarters and add them to the sauce. Cover and place in the fridge to chill, stirring the mixture regularly.

4. To serve, heat the butter in a large frying pan. Drain the pineapple slices and cook them on one side only until golden brown. Transfer to a serving dish.

5. Pile the strawberries into the centre of the pineapple slices and spoon the sauce around the outside before serving.

easy
 
Serves: 4
Prep: 15 min
Cook: 2 hrs 5 min
 
 

Ingredients

4 slices fresh pineapple, about 2.5cm thick
600ml stock syrup
2 cardamom pods, crushed
280g Strawberries
splash orange liqueur
1/2 lemon, juice only
55g icing sugar
2 oranges, zest only
55g unsalted Butter
